Where the growth came from
Seventeen Mile Rocks - Sinnamon Park gained 672 residents from internal migration and 126 from overseas in the year to June 2025, while 752 people moved away — a net addition of 46 before natural increase.
Components of change, 2024–25 sample period. Natural increase is shown separately from migration so the two are not read as one figure.
Estimated resident population
Seventeen Mile Rocks - Sinnamon Park against the Queensland average, rebased to the first year shown.
Seventeen Mile Rocks - Sinnamon Park population grew from 10,022 in 2016 to 9,886 in 2025, a change of -1.4% over the period, against the Queensland average.
Show data table
| Year | Seventeen Mile Rocks - Sinnamon Park | Queensland average |
|---|---|---|
| 2016 | 10,022 | 4,845,152 |
| 2017 | 9,980 | 4,926,380 |
| 2018 | 9,965 | 5,006,623 |
| 2019 | 9,944 | 5,088,847 |
| 2020 | 9,934 | 5,165,613 |
| 2021 | 9,833 | 5,215,814 |
| 2022 | 9,795 | 5,310,905 |
| 2023 | 9,877 | 5,450,235 |
| 2024 | 9,908 | 5,571,890 |
| 2025 | 9,886 | 5,669,764 |

Facilities & amenities
What OpenStreetMap records inside the SA2 boundary. Counts reflect features tagged in OSM and can undercount a real, less-mapped area; public pools exclude private backyard pools where tagged.
Within the Seventeen Mile Rocks - Sinnamon Park SA2, OpenStreetMap records 2 childcare and kindergarten centres, 1 GP or clinic location, 1 supermarket and 25 parks. For families: 14 playgrounds. Eating out and socialising: 3 cafés, 3 restaurants and 1 pub or bar. Staying active: 1 gym, 3 public pools and 6 sports fields. Also 1 cinema. The nearest train station, Darra station, is about 2,250 m from the suburb centre. OpenStreetMap also maps 49 bus stops here.
